#### Installed system unit for VNC Server in Service Mode Mode Daemon
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Start or stop service with: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
```
|
|
||||||
systemctl (start-stop) vncserver-x11-service.service
|
|
||||||
```
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Mark or unmark the service to be started at boot time with: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
```
|
|
||||||
systemctl (enable-disable) vncserver-x11-service.service
|
|
||||||
```
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
How to kill all Process: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
```
|
|
||||||
killall vncserver-x11-core vncserver-x11 vncagent vncserverui
|
|
||||||
```

## Mode B: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Another way run Virtual Mode Daemon:
|
|
||||||
(Custom way without license)
|
|
||||||
(From Pi forum https://www.raspberrypi.org/forums/viewtopic.php?t=249124)
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Do as the follow steps: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
1. Install a package: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
apt install xserver-xorg-video-dummy -y
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
2. Run command: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
killall vncserver-x11-core vncserver-x11 vncagent vncserverui ;\
|
|
||||||
systemctl stop vncserver-x11-serviced.service ;\
|
|
||||||
systemctl disable vncserver-x11-serviced.service ;\
|
|
||||||
systemctl stop vncserver-virtuald.service ;\
|
|
||||||
systemctl disable vncserver-virtuald.service
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
3. Create a service script: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
/usr/lib/systemd/system/vncserver-pi.service
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
---------------------------------------------------
|
|
||||||
[Unit]
|
|
||||||
Description=VNC Server in Virtual Mode daemon
|
|
||||||
After=network.target
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
[Service]
|
|
||||||
User=pi
|
|
||||||
Type=forking
|
|
||||||
ExecStart=/usr/bin/vncserver :1
|
|
||||||
ExecStop=/usr/bin/vncserver -kill :1
|
|
||||||
Restart=on-failure
|
|
||||||
RestartSec=5
|
|
||||||
KillMode=process
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
[Install]
|
|
||||||
WantedBy=multi-user.target
|
|
||||||
---------------------------------------------------
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
4. To enable the system Xorg server for all users, run: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
vncinitconfig -enable-system-xorg
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
All answers need to choose "Y"
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
If you wanna disable, run: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
vncinitconfig -disable-system-xorg
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
5. Generate a "/etc/X11/vncserver-virtual.conf" conf file, run: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
vncinitconfig -virtual-xorg-conf
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
6. Then enable and start service:
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
systemctl enable vncserver-pi.service
|
|
||||||
systemctl start vncserver-pi.service
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Known issue:
|
|
||||||
This mode isn't support restart vncserver-pi.service
|
|
||||||
You need to reboot system.
